When spending your winter holiday in Poland, make sure to visit the thermal baths! Termy Chochołowskie is the largest complex of thermal pools in Podhale (with 30 pool basins). This means that you will find there plenty of different attractions for everyone – whether you are going alone, with your family or with a group of friends!
In the area of swimming pools, exciting attractions await you: geysers, an artificial wave, a rapid river, whirlpools and much more! In the mood for a thrill? Try the pontoon slide (164 metres long) or the climbing net! If you want to spend time actively by simply swimming – visit the sports pool (25×10 metres). Don’t forget about the healing zone with thermal pools. You can choose from many options with different qualities such as iodised brine water (32°C) and raw, sulfuric thermal water (36°C) or relax in the brine jacuzzi. For the little ones – a special children’s zone including a water playground, slides and paddling pool.
Bathing in thermal waters is not only pleasant and relaxing but also has many health benefits. The elements and minerals contained in the water, among other things: benefit the nervous system, speed up the metabolism, reduce muscle and joint pain and can combat insomnia. They are also great for the skin, making it smoother and firmer.
Within the complex, guests receive special watches with which they can pay in the restaurant or the water bars. For an additional charge, you can also use the sports centre or the swimming accessories shop.
